    Quote Originally Posted by mike1234 View Post
    Bill - just curious about the technology. What did you guys do to make it more scalable? On the front-end, it seems to be the same AJAX setup.

    Not a big deal if you can't divulge.

    Thanks.
    The architecture is very different. We use an archive engine and a new caching engine. We no longer have to build add-onns for every feed we take in or every website we want to support... like sbrcontests. It uses much less server resources per user and per action. We couldn't support 30k users on the old one ad do play by play for all games at once. The new dynamic spreadsheet we are planning couldn't be built with old odds since each set of saved games will be their own set league created by thousands of people. ,The old one was good for its time but we needed to solve the riddle. People liked it because it loaded everything in the background so it appeared fast.

    Quote Originally Posted by mike1234 View Post
    Bill - just curious about the technology. What did you guys do to make it more scalable? On the front-end, it seems to be the same AJAX setup.

    Not a big deal if you can't divulge.

    Thanks.
    You're right, the frontend is the same as before more or less. The whole architecture is designed better behind the website. The way it was designed before was almost maxed out in how it scaled. If the first 2 servers for the old site supported 1000 users adding a 3rd server might support 1300, a 4th might be 1500 you can see where the problem is, eventually we can't have any more users. We also created a much more highly available solution, loosing a server to hardware failure isn't any issue any more, making updates to the system doesn't take the site offline etc...

    We had some problems when we first launched the new site because we were using a lot of new technologies, now we've fixed most of those problems with the architecture and we can start working on adding more features, new books, speed of the updates and data quality issues.
